4R Nutrient stewardship learning modules for extension agents
by African Plant Nutrition Institute (APNI)

This short course focuses on best nutrient management in Africa and is consistent with the principles and practices of 4R Nutrient Stewardship. 4R Nutrient Stewardship practices are designed to provide plants with the right source of nutrients, at the right rate, right time, and right place. Balancing each of these “rights” will help you to ensure that plants have access to proper nutrition throughout their growing season and in turn generate profitable yields and prevent soil nutrient depletion and minimize environmental harm.
